The sister-in-law of your father's only brother could be your mother.
If, instead, she is the sister of your uncle's wife, she is not related to you at all. You share no common ancestor with her.
There are two ways your father's only brother can have a sister-in-law.If the brother marries someone who has a sister, that sister is his sister-in-law and is not related to you.The other sister-in-law he can have is the wife of his brother, i.e. your father's wife, also known as your mother.

If your sister-in-law is the sister of your spouse, her brother is your brother-in-law (or your husband if you are a woman).If your sister-in-law is the wife of your brother, then her brother is not related to you.
